Summary
MIR635 (microRNA 635, HGNC:32891) is a microRNA gene on chromosome 17q24.2.
microRNAs (miRNAs) are short (20-24 nt) non-coding RNAs that are involved in post-transcriptional regulation of gene expression in multicellular organisms by affecting both the stability and translation of mRNAs. miRNAs are transcribed by RNA polymerase II as part of capped and polyadenylated primary transcripts (pri-miRNAs) that can be either protein-coding or non-coding. The primary transcript is cleaved by the Drosha ribonuclease III enzyme to produce an approximately 70-nt stem-loop precursor miRNA (pre-miRNA), which is further cleaved by the cytoplasmic Dicer ribonuclease to generate the mature miRNA and antisense miRNA star (miRNA*) products. The mature miRNA is incorporated into a RNA-induced silencing complex (RISC), which recognizes target mRNAs through imperfect base pairing with the miRNA and most commonly results in translational inhibition or destabilization of the target mRNA. The RefSeq represents the predicted microRNA stem-loop.

Literature-anchored findings (GeneRIF, showing 5)
- These results have suggested a novel tumor suppressive role for miR-635 in non-small cell lung cancer. (PMID:27810784)
- miR-635 targets KIFC1 to inhibit the progression of gastric cancer. (PMID:32753405)
- Circ_0000735 enhances the proliferation, metastasis and glycolysis of non-small cell lung cancer by regulating the miR-635/FAM83F axis. (PMID:33560141)
- Long noncoding RNADUXAP8 regulates TOP2A in the growth and metastasis of osteosarcoma via microRNA635. (PMID:33982765)
- Circ_0102231 inactivates the PI3K/AKT signaling pathway by regulating the miR-635/NOVA2 pathway to promote the progression of non-small cell lung cancer. (PMID:37864285)
